About Arbitrum
Arbitrum positions itself as the enterprise-grade infrastructure for global finance, consumer, and gaming applications onchain. It offers a flexible platform allowing users to either build an app on Arbitrum One (using Solidity or Stylus, which supports Rust, C, and C++) or launch a fully customizable dedicated chain with configurable gas tokens, governance, access controls, and privacy. The platform emphasizes performance, confidentiality, customization, and compliance for institutional and blockchain-native developers alike. Arbitrum's ecosystem hosts hundreds of finance, consumer, and gaming applications, including major DeFi protocols like Aave, Pendle, GMX, Morpho, and Uniswap, as well as consumer and gaming projects such as The Beacon, Otherside, Wildcard, and Golden Tides. Clients and partners range from institutional finance players (e.g., Robinhood) to Web3-native consumer apps and game studios, reflecting its focus on serving both enterprise-grade finance use cases and mass-adoption consumer/gaming experiences.

About the Role
You'll work with the Director of Accounting to help scale core accounting operations, take ownership of the month-end close for a multi-entity organization, and support key processes across compliance, payroll, and financial reporting. You'll thrive in a high-growth environment, solving complex blockchain related problems while helping build for scale with a mindset focused on automation, documentation, and continuous improvement.
Requirements
- 8 years of progressive accounting experience, including time in fast-paced, high-growth SaaS, or tech environments
- 2 years in public accounting, CPA is a plus
- Blockchain experience is a plus, but not required
- Strong understanding of US GAAP, with hands-on experience managing general ledger and close processes
- Proficiency with accounting systems like QuickBooks, and finance tools like Brex, Ramp, Deel, and Stripe
- Experience managing or supporting multi-entity accounting, international operations, or tax compliance a plus
- Takes ownership, communicates clearly, and brings a roll-up-your-sleeves attitude to problem solving and cross-functional collaboration
- Experience working in a fast-paced startup or global remote environment is a plus
Responsibilities
- Lead and manage the month-end close process, including preparation of journal entries, account reconciliations, and supporting schedules for accruals, prepaids, fixed assets, and reclasses
- Support the Head of Finance with financial reporting across multiple entities, including consolidation, monthly close packages, variance analysis, investor reporting, and audit preparation
- Assist with tax requests from the outside tax firm
- Drive improvements in accounting systems and integrations
- Assist with technical accounting research and process documentation, including ASC 606 revenue recognition and ASC 842 lease accounting
- Aid in strategic projects, such as post-merger balance sheet and multi-entity consolidations, and ERP readiness initiatives
- Partner cross-functionally with internal stakeholders to improve billing operations and customer balance workflows
- Calculate the financial impact of blockchain transactions within the General Ledger
